I got my schedule for school finished yesterday. I am absolutely in love with my schedule. Wish America had this system. Basically every class meets once a week in a huge lecture hall for the lecture where we are just talked at anywhere from 1-3 hours (this always depends on the class and how much lecture time it demands). Then other than that the same class has then usually has a tutorial meeting time which has less students (probably 20 people or so.. im unsure) that lasts only an hour. I actually have made it so my tutorials and lectures for each class are on the same day so i have four classes, one on each day (including the lecture and the tutorial) it will be nice because i will get to focus on just one class a day. O and i dont have class on Monday so that is nice aswell. I will be taking a class with my friend Allison one day and on another day I have class with Jeff (the guy from APU) so i guess in my other two classes I will be making some friends.... haha. O yes and for those who do not know, I have already said i am only taking 4 classes, but do not worry that is normal here. yes that means i will only be able to transfer four classes to APU but fortunately each class here is 4 units so i will get to still transfer 16 units back to school so it will still be a full semester of units.
